Verb conjugation

Conjugate To sum in english

Regular verb
sum, summed, summed

Indicative

Present (simple)

  • I sum
  • you sum
  • he sums
  • we sum
  • you sum
  • they sum

Present progressive / continuous

  • I am summing
  • you are summing
  • he is summing
  • we are summing
  • you are summing
  • they are summing

Past (simple)

  • I summed
  • you summed
  • he summed
  • we summed
  • you summed
  • they summed

Past progressive / continuous

  • I was summing
  • you were summing
  • he was summing
  • we were summing
  • you were summing
  • they were summing

Present perfect (simple)

  • I have summed
  • you have summed
  • he has summed
  • we have summed
  • you have summed
  • they have summed

Present perfect progressive / continuous

  • I have been summing
  • you have been summing
  • he has been summing
  • we have been summing
  • you have been summing
  • they have been summing

Past perfect

  • I had summed
  • you had summed
  • he had summed
  • we had summed
  • you had summed
  • they had summed

Past perfect progressive / continuous

  • I had been summing
  • you had been summing
  • he had been summing
  • we had been summing
  • you had been summing
  • they had been summing

Future

  • I will sum
  • you will sum
  • he will sum
  • we will sum
  • you will sum
  • they will sum

Future progressive / continuous

  • I will be summing
  • you will be summing
  • he will be summing
  • we will be summing
  • you will be summing
  • they will be summing

Future perfect

  • I will have summed
  • you will have summed
  • he will have summed
  • we will have summed
  • you will have summed
  • they will have summed

Future perfect continuous

  • I will have been summing
  • you will have been summing
  • he will have been summing
  • we will have been summing
  • you will have been summing
  • they will have been summing

Conditional

Simple

  • I would sum
  • you would sum
  • he would sum
  • we would sum
  • you would sum
  • they would sum

Progressive

  • I would be summing
  • you would be summing
  • he would be summing
  • we would be summing
  • you would be summing
  • they would be summing

Perfect

  • I would have summed
  • you would have summed
  • he would have summed
  • we would have summed
  • you would have summed
  • they would have summed

Perfect progressive

  • I would have been summing
  • you would have been summing
  • he would have been summing
  • we would have been summing
  • you would have been summing
  • they would have been summing

Infinitive

Infinitive

  • to sum

Imperative

Imperative

  • sum
  • Let's sum
